Keeping in mind safety, homeowners and contractors must use GFCI protection while doing electrical repairs in damp areas, such as kitchens, bathrooms, or basements. Portable ground fault circuit interrupters are electrical devices that are used with power cords to prevent electric shocks, and fires around homes, places of work. They are designed with integrated circuit breakers that switch off the electrical supply in the event of a current overload.
